EXCEEDS logo
Exceeds
Carolyn Sullivan

PROFILE

Carolyn Sullivan

Chris Sullivan focused on enhancing French localization for process management UIs in both the 4Science/dspace-angular and DSpace/dspace-angular repositories. Over two months, Chris updated fr.json5 files to deliver targeted translations for deletion flows, error handling, and auto-refresh status messaging, ensuring a more consistent and accessible experience for French-speaking users. The work involved cross-repository coordination, careful JSON5 editing, and validation of translation accuracy, demonstrating proficiency in internationalization workflows and Angular-based UI patterns. By standardizing terminology and improving translation coverage, Chris reduced user friction and supported broader internationalization goals, though the work did not involve direct bug fixes during this period.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

6Total
Bugs
0
Commits
6
Features
4
Lines of code
102
Activity Months2

Work History

February 2025

3 Commits • 2 Features

Feb 1, 2025

February 2025 monthly summary: French localization improvements for process management UIs across 4Science/dspace-angular and DSpace/dspace-angular, updating fr.json5 with translations for process detail actions (cancel, confirm, delete), error and success messages, headers, and auto-refresh indicators; enabled a clearer FR UX and more reliable deletion workflows.

November 2024

3 Commits • 2 Features

Nov 1, 2024

November 2024 monthly summary focused on delivering targeted French localization enhancements across two DSpace Angular repositories, improving the process deletion flow, status messaging, and the process management UI for French users. In 4Science/dspace-angular, delivered translations for deletion confirmation messages and error handling with a placeholder for a 'refreshing' status in fr.json5. In DSpace/dspace-angular, expanded French localizations for the process management UI, including process.detail translations and an auto-refreshing status label, also via fr.json5 updates. No major bugs fixed this month; however, localization polish across repositories reduces user friction and supports broader internationalization goals. Technical achievements include cross-repo localization work, updates to fr.json5, and demonstrating proficiency with Angular-based UI patterns and i18n workflows.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JSON

Technical Skills

Internationalization

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

DSpace/dspace-angular

Nov 2024 Feb 2025
2 Months active

Languages Used

JSON

Technical Skills

Internationalization

4Science/dspace-angular

Nov 2024 Feb 2025
2 Months active

Languages Used

JSON

Technical Skills

Internationalization

Generated by Exceeds AIThis report is designed for sharing and indexing